Started in 1402, Seville's cathedral is the largest Gothic structure in the world, and the the third largest cathedral in all of christianity, occupying 22.720 square meters. It was built on top of an old huge mosque. At the beginning of construction, they were heard to say: “Let us build so great a church that any who did see the finished result should think us mad.”

They completely leveled the old mosque, unfortunately. The only structure conserved was the bell tower that used to be a minaret for the old mosque. Everything else was built from scratch.
